Residential Smart Air Conditioner Market was valued at USD 2.5 Billion in 2022 and is projected to reach USD 7.5 Billion by 2030, growing at a CAGR of 15.2% from 2024 to 2030.
The residential smart air conditioner market is evolving rapidly due to the growing demand for energy-efficient and user-friendly cooling solutions in homes. Smart air conditioners integrate advanced technologies like IoT (Internet of Things), AI (Artificial Intelligence), and automation, providing homeowners with enhanced control, energy savings, and improved comfort. These devices are designed to be compatible with home automation systems, enabling remote operation and monitoring via smartphones or voice-controlled assistants like Amazon Alexa and Google Assistant. This development is creating opportunities for consumers to optimize their indoor climate efficiently while reducing energy consumption and minimizing environmental impact. Smart air conditioners are also offering features such as self-diagnosis, real-time performance monitoring, and customizable cooling schedules, all of which contribute to a more sustainable and comfortable living environment.

The residential smart air conditioner market is witnessing several key trends that are shaping its growth trajectory. One of the most prominent trends is the increasing integration of AI and IoT technologies, allowing air conditioners to optimize their performance based on real-time data and user preferences. Smart air conditioners now feature self-learning capabilities, enabling them to adjust temperature settings based on usage patterns and external weather conditions. This trend not only enhances user comfort but also results in significant energy savings, which is increasingly important to environmentally conscious consumers. Another key trend is the growing emphasis on energy efficiency, driven by both consumer demand for reduced electricity bills and stricter environmental regulations. Many manufacturers are focusing on creating energy-efficient products that provide high-performance cooling with lower energy consumption, thus helping to reduce the carbon footprint of residential cooling systems.Another significant trend is the rise of smart home integration. Residential smart air conditioners are becoming more seamlessly integrated with other smart home devices, such as smart thermostats, lighting, and voice assistants. This interconnectedness enables homeowners to create customized, automated schedules and improve the overall efficiency of their home systems. As voice-activated systems like Amazon Alexa and Google Assistant gain more popularity, smart air conditioners are increasingly being designed to be compatible with these platforms, allowing users to control their air conditioners using simple voice commands. This trend reflects the growing demand for convenience, control, and flexibility in managing home appliances. Additionally, there is a shift towards the use of environmentally friendly refrigerants and sustainable materials in the production of smart air conditioners, further aligning with global sustainability efforts.

1. What is a smart air conditioner?
A smart air conditioner is an air conditioning unit equipped with advanced technologies such as IoT and AI, enabling users to control and monitor it remotely via smartphones or voice assistants.
2. How do smart air conditioners save energy?
Smart air conditioners optimize cooling based on usage patterns, weather data, and personal preferences, reducing energy consumption by adjusting temperature settings and operation schedules.
3. Can smart air conditioners be controlled remotely?
Yes, smart air conditioners can be controlled remotely using smartphone apps, voice commands via platforms like Alexa or Google Assistant, or through home automation systems.
4. What are the benefits of using a smart air conditioner?
Smart air conditioners offer enhanced energy efficiency, personalized comfort, remote control, and integration with other smart home devices for a more seamless living experience.
5. Are smart air conditioners more expensive than traditional ones?
Yes, smart air conditioners tend to be more expensive initially due to the advanced technologies and features they offer, but they can save money over time through energy efficiency.
6. How does smart home integration work with air conditioners?
Smart air conditioners can be connected to other smart home devices like thermostats, lights, and voice assistants, allowing users to control them via a single interface or automate their operation.
7. Do smart air conditioners require a Wi-Fi connection?
Yes, most smart air conditioners require a Wi-Fi connection for remote control and integration with other smart home devices.
8. Can I install a smart air conditioner myself?
While some models are designed for easy installation, it's generally recommended to have a professional install a smart air conditioner to ensure proper setup and performance.
9. How can I ensure my smart air conditioner is energy-efficient?
Look for smart air conditioners with energy-saving modes, programmable timers, and features that adjust the cooling according to room occupancy and temperature conditions.
10. What is the lifespan of a smart air conditioner?
The lifespan of a smart air conditioner typically ranges from 10 to 15 years, depending on usage, maintenance, and the quality of the unit.
